2006 | ||
---|---|---|
35 | EE | Jun Nakano, Pablo Montesinos, Kourosh Gharachorloo, Josep Torrellas: ReViveI/O: efficient handling of I/O in highly-available rollback-recovery servers. HPCA 2006: 200-211 |
2001 | ||
34 | EE | Alex Ramírez, Luiz André Barroso, Kourosh Gharachorloo, Robert S. Cohn, Josep-Lluis Larriba-Pey, P. Geoffrey Lowney, Mateo Valero: Code layout optimizations for transaction processing workloads. ISCA 2001: 155-164 |
2000 | ||
33 | EE | Kourosh Gharachorloo, Madhu Sharma, Simon Steely, Stephen Van Doren: Architecture and design of AlphaServer GS320. ASPLOS 2000: 13-24 |
32 | EE | Luiz André Barroso, Kourosh Gharachorloo, Andreas Nowatzyk, Ben Verghese: Impact of Chip-Level Integration on Performance of OLTP Workloads. HPCA 2000: 3-14 |
31 | EE | Luiz André Barroso, Kourosh Gharachorloo, Robert McNamara, Andreas Nowatzyk, Shaz Qadeer, Barton Sano, Scott Smith, Robert Stets, Ben Verghese: Piranha: a scalable architecture based on single-chip multiprocessing. ISCA 2000: 282-293 |
1999 | ||
30 | EE | Sandhya Dwarkadas, Kourosh Gharachorloo, Leonidas I. Kontothanassis, Daniel J. Scales, Michael L. Scott, Robert Stets: Comparative Evaluation of Fine- and Coarse-Grain Approaches for Software Distributed Shared Memory. HPCA 1999: 260-269 |
1998 | ||
29 | EE | Kourosh Gharachorloo, Daniel Lenoski, James Laudon, Phillip B. Gibbons, Anoop Gupta, John L. Hennessy: Memory Consistency and Event Ordering in Scalable Shared-Memory Multiprocessors. 25 Years ISCA: Retrospectives and Reprints 1998: 376-387 |
28 | EE | Jeffrey Kuskin, David Ofelt, Mark Heinrich, John Heinlein, Richard Simoni, Kourosh Gharachorloo, John Chapin, David Nakahira, Joel Baxter, Mark Horowitz, Anoop Gupta, Mendel Rosenblum, John L. Hennessy: The Stanford FLASH Multiprocessor. 25 Years ISCA: Retrospectives and Reprints 1998: 485-496 |
27 | EE | Kourosh Gharachorloo: Retrospective: Memory Consistency and Event Ordering in Scalable Shared-Memory Multiprocessors. 25 Years ISCA: Retrospectives and Reprints 1998: 67-70 |
26 | EE | Parthasarathy Ranganathan, Kourosh Gharachorloo, Sarita V. Adve, Luiz André Barroso: Performance of Database Workloads on Shared-Memory Systems with Out-of-Order Processors. ASPLOS 1998: 307-318 |
25 | EE | Daniel J. Scales, Kourosh Gharachorloo, Anshu Aggarwal: Fine-Grain Software Distributed Shared Memory on SMP Clusters. HPCA 1998: 125-136 |
24 | EE | Luiz André Barroso, Kourosh Gharachorloo, Edouard Bugnion: Memory System Characterization of Commercial Workloads. ISCA 1998: 3-14 |
23 | EE | Vijayaraghavan Soundararajan, Mark Heinrich, Ben Verghese, Kourosh Gharachorloo, Anoop Gupta, John L. Hennessy: Flexible Use of Memory for Replication/Migration in Cache-Coherent DSM Multiprocessors. ISCA 1998: 342-355 |
22 | EE | Jack L. Lo, Luiz André Barroso, Susan J. Eggers, Kourosh Gharachorloo, Henry M. Levy, Sujay S. Parekh: An Analysis of Database Workload Performance on Simultaneous Multithreaded Processors. ISCA 1998: 39-50 |
1997 | ||
21 | EE | John Heinlein, Kourosh Gharachorloo, Robert P. Bosch Jr., Mendel Rosenblum, Anoop Gupta: Coherent Block Data Transfer in the FLASH Multiprocessor. IPPS 1997: 18-27 |
20 | EE | Daniel J. Scales, Kourosh Gharachorloo: Design and Performance of the Shasta Distributed Shared Memory Protocol. International Conference on Supercomputing 1997: 245-252 |
19 | Daniel J. Scales, Kourosh Gharachorloo: Shasta: A System for Supporting Fine-Grain Shared Memory Across Clusters. PPSC 1997 | |
18 | Daniel J. Scales, Kourosh Gharachorloo: Towards Transparent and Efficient Software Distributed Shared Memory. SOSP 1997: 157-169 | |
1996 | ||
17 | Daniel J. Scales, Kourosh Gharachorloo, Chandramohan A. Thekkath: Shasta: A Low Overhead, Software-Only Approach for Supporting Fine-Grain Shared Memory. ASPLOS 1996: 174-185 | |
16 | Sarita V. Adve, Kourosh Gharachorloo: Shared Memory Consistency Models: A Tutorial. IEEE Computer 29(12): 66-76 (1996) | |
1994 | ||
15 | Mark Heinrich, Jeffrey Kuskin, David Ofelt, John Heinlein, Joel Baxter, Jaswinder Pal Singh, Richard Simoni, Kourosh Gharachorloo, David Nakahira, Mark Horowitz, Anoop Gupta, Mendel Rosenblum, John L. Hennessy: The Performance Impact of Flexibility in the Stanford FLASH Multiprocessor. ASPLOS 1994: 274-285 | |
14 | John Heinlein, Kourosh Gharachorloo, Scott Dresser, Anoop Gupta: Integration of Message Passing and Shared Memory in the Stanford FLASH Multiprocessor. ASPLOS 1994: 38-50 | |
13 | Jeffrey Kuskin, David Ofelt, Mark Heinrich, John Heinlein, Richard Simoni, Kourosh Gharachorloo, John Chapin, David Nakahira, Joel Baxter, Mark Horowitz, Anoop Gupta, Mendel Rosenblum, John L. Hennessy: The Stanford FLASH Multiprocessor. ISCA 1994: 302-313 | |
12 | EE | Rohit Chandra, Kourosh Gharachorloo, Vijayaraghavan Soundararajan, Anoop Gupta: Performance evaluation of hybrid hardware and software distributed shared memory protocols. International Conference on Supercomputing 1994: 274-288 |
1992 | ||
11 | Kourosh Gharachorloo, Anoop Gupta, John L. Hennessy: Hiding Memory Latency using Dynamic Scheduling in Shared-Memory Multiprocessors. ISCA 1992: 22-33 | |
10 | Daniel Lenoski, James Laudon, Kourosh Gharachorloo, Wolf-Dietrich Weber, Anoop Gupta, John L. Hennessy, Mark Horowitz, Monica S. Lam: The Stanford Dash Multiprocessor. IEEE Computer 25(3): 63-79 (1992) | |
9 | Kourosh Gharachorloo, Sarita V. Adve, Anoop Gupta, John L. Hennessy, Mark D. Hill: Programming for Different Memory Consistency Models. J. Parallel Distrib. Comput. 15(4): 399-407 (1992) | |
1991 | ||
8 | Kourosh Gharachorloo, Anoop Gupta, John L. Hennessy: Performance Evaluation of Memory Consistency Models for Shared Memory Multiprocessors. ASPLOS 1991: 245-257 | |
7 | Kourosh Gharachorloo, Anoop Gupta, John L. Hennessy: Two Techniques to Enhance the Performance of Memory Consistency Models. ICPP (1) 1991: 355-364 | |
6 | EE | Anoop Gupta, John L. Hennessy, Kourosh Gharachorloo, Todd C. Mowry, Wolf-Dietrich Weber: Comparative Evaluation of Latency Reducing and Tolerating Techniques. ISCA 1991: 254-263 |
5 | EE | Phillip B. Gibbons, Michael Merritt, Kourosh Gharachorloo: Proving Sequential Consistency of High-Performance Shared Memories (Extended Abstract). SPAA 1991: 292-303 |
4 | EE | Kourosh Gharachorloo, Phillip B. Gibbons: Detecting Violations of Sequential Consistency. SPAA 1991: 316-326 |
1990 | ||
3 | Daniel Lenoski, James Laudon, Kourosh Gharachorloo, Anoop Gupta, John L. Hennessy: The Directory-Based Cache Coherence Protocol for the DASH Multiprocessor. ISCA 1990: 148-159 | |
2 | Kourosh Gharachorloo, Daniel Lenoski, James Laudon, Phillip B. Gibbons, Anoop Gupta, John L. Hennessy: Memory Consistency and Event Ordering in Scalable Shared-Memory Multiprocessors. ISCA 1990: 15-26 | |
1988 | ||
1 | EE | Kourosh Gharachorloo, Vivek Sarkar, John L. Hennessy: A Simple and Efficient Implmentation Approach for Single Assignment Languages. LISP and Functional Programming 1988: 259-268 |